Default potenza RE040 in rain

Hi Folks,

It has been raining pretty heavily in the bay area. I'm noticing how bad the car (has 10.5K miles) behaves on wet roads; especially on newly laid/renovated highways. It's normal for my car to sway a foot (2 ft sometimes) sideways when I'm going at 55-60 mph (under the speed limit). Is it the tires or is it a combination of the tires and the fact that they feather so easily? I'm due at the dealership next week to have them "look" at it.

My good 'ol 94 integra GSR with 8 month old Good year eagles drives straight as an arrow in inches of rain.

I wouldnt put 275 on stock rims... they fit very very nicely on my 9.5" rims, no bulge at all. I wouldnt go over 255 personally.

either way. a wider tire will always be worse in rain, some less than others, but none great. like a water ski. the longer and wider it is, the more it can ride over the water. your teg has 4 water skis. your Z has 4 wake boards. it just has to move the water in the center even farther to get it out of the way, so some becomes trapped and lifts the car up.

the brand of tires is only partially responsible. just not fair to compare a measily mid 100's hp fwd(with what Id guess to be 195 maybe 205 tires?) teg to a 287hp rwd Z with 245 stock rubber. it wasnt meant to be the most practical car in inclement weather, I wouldnt call that a flaw in the car, just the nature of the beast.

Default Part of your problem here...

I agree that the RE040s are not the best tires in the rain...but think about this.

1) A tire's rain performance is often dependent on the depth of various grooves.

2) At 10,000 miles you might be near the end of your RE040 tires (I expect mine to last 15k if I'm lucky). Typically as tires go bad, their dry traction stays the same or can even improve while wet traction deteriorates. I have 4k miles on mine, and during heavy rains the car is stable at around 55-60. I know I'll take flack b/c some people might get 20k out of their RE040s...I just have no idea how the hell they do that.
